Sheet Metal Design Guidelines for Designing Parts

Sheet Metal Design Guidelines for Designing Parts

 

Sheet metal parts form the core of countless products we use every day. They turn circuit boards and mechanical drawings into real, working items that last. A well-made sheet metal housing often decides whether a medical device feels trustworthy, an outdoor kiosk survives years of weather, or a classroom podium stands up to daily student use. The jump from a perfect 3D model to hundreds or thousands of good parts on the shelf comes down to following proven design rules that match real factory capabilities. When engineers respect those rules, brackets, enclosures, and frames come out right the first time, cost less, and reach the market faster.

The Indispensable Role of Sheet Metal in Modern Industry

Why Precision Sheet Metal Components Matter

Fabricators start with flat sheets of metal – usually stainless steel, aluminum, or cold-rolled steel – and cut, bend, and join them into finished pieces. The result is strong, light when needed, and almost always cheaper in volume than machined or cast alternatives. Factories can make thousands of identical parts quickly, assembly lines run smoothly, and the final product costs less while lasting longer.

Foundational Design Principles for Sheet Metal Parts

Material Selection: Balancing Functionality and Environment

Pick the wrong material and the part fails in the field; pick the right one and it works for years. At San Jun Hardware, we regularly stock and process:

Cold-rolled steel – easy to form, strong enough for furniture frames and machine guards.

Stainless steel – fights rust and looks clean, perfect for hospitals and food equipment.

Galvanized steel – zinc coating keeps outdoor pieces from rusting.

Aluminum – light and good at moving heat away, common in electronics and battery boxes.

For outdoor battery enclosures, for example, we often suggest 5052 aluminum because it handles heat cycles and stays light.

Prioritizing Manufacturability (DFM)

Good parts start on the computer screen. A few basic rules save money and headaches later.

Bend Radii and Reliefs

Keep the inside bend radius at least equal to material thickness (example: 1.5 mm steel → minimum 1.5 mm radius). Smaller radii crack the outside surface. We also add small relief notches at the ends of bend lines so the flat pattern stays accurate.

Hole and Feature Placement

Never put a hole closer than 2× material thickness from a bend line. On our brakes, the distance from a hole edge to the bend line needs to stay at least 3 mm plus the bend radius, otherwise the hole distorts. Our typical position tolerance between a hole and a nearby bend is ±0.2 mm.

Part Simplification

Every extra jog or deep draw adds a forming step and sometimes a second tool. Whenever possible, use the same bend radius throughout the part and keep flanges the same length – the turret press and brake can run faster, and tooling stays cheaper.

Core Fabrication Processes and Their Design Implications

Precision Cutting: Setting the Standard for Accuracy

Everything begins with a clean blank. We cut most parts on 3000 W fiber lasers or CNC turret punches. For 0.5–2.0 mm material, laser cutting holds ±0.1 mm on the flat pattern (before bending). Straight dimensions that do not cross bend lines also stay within ±0.1 mm, which means tabs and slots line up perfectly when the part is folded.

Bending and Forming: Managing Geometry and Stress

After cutting, blanks go to the CNC press brakes. Metal always springs back a few degrees, so we slightly over-bend and let it relax to the correct angle. Standard bending tolerance across one or more bends is ±0.4 mm on flange length and ±1° on angle unless the drawing calls for tighter.

Welding and Assembly: Ensuring Structural Integrity

Many enclosures need several pieces joined together. We use MIG for thicker steel, TIG for stainless and aluminum, and spot welding when appearance matters. Final assembly includes PEM nuts, studs, rivets (on our Hager automatic riveting press), and hinges, so the finished box is ready to accept electronics or screens right away.

Enhancing Durability and Aesthetics Through Finishing

A bare metal part rusts or scratches quickly. Finishing protects it and makes it look professional.

Surface Treatments for Protection and Appearance

Powder coating – tough colored finish, any RAL or Pantone shade, matte or semi-gloss.

Anodizing – only on aluminum, builds a hard oxide layer up to 20–25 μm thick.

Zinc or nickel plating plus passivation on stainless – extra corrosion protection without changing the look stays the same.

For outdoor kiosks, we almost always powder-coat after welding because the coating seals every seam against rain.

Achieving Precise Tolerances

Countersinks, threaded holes, and locating pins all need tight control. Our machined countersink major diameter usually stays within ±0.254 mm, so every screw sits flush.
